Phew, I made it! Today, 31st March (ending in Japan in another 30 10 minutes), is Maaya Sakamoto’s birthday! HAPPY BIRTHDAY! お誕生日おめでとう! Yay! For the uninitiated, Maaya is the talented singer whose songs are featured in Escaflowne (she also voiced Hitomi), RahXephon and Wolf’s Rain. She also happens to be my most favourite-st artiste ever. Anyway, Korean pop artiste Ivy recently had a music video “Temptation of Sonata” banned from TV because it ripped off recreated a scene from Final Fantasy 7 Advent Children without Square’s consent.
